Latest clinical evidence and injection recommendations
advocate shorter needles
The latest injection technique recommendations published in Diabetes and Metabolism (2010) mentions the following. “Shorter needles are safer and are often better tolerated…Initial therapies should begin with shorter needles. Shorter needles reduce the risk of injecting into the muscle. 4, 5 and 6mm needles may be used by any adult patient including obese ones.”
There is no medical reason to use a needle longer than 6mm.
